Marion is a senior Microsoft Power Platform and SharePoint consultant with 15+ years of experience. He delivers scalable solutions for organizations like the CDC, Booz Allen Hamilton, and INPO. Marion specializes in workflow automation, SharePoint migrations, and building intuitive business apps that streamline operations and enhance productivity in SharePoint or Microsoft Power Platform.

Legacy Workflow Migration to Microsoft Power Automate

I spearheaded the end-to-end migration of over 100 legacy Nintex workflows and forms to Microsoft Power Automate for the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C). This high-impact project supported a broader modernization effort, moving from SharePoint 2013 to SharePoint Online under an aggressive deadline. The migration involved workflow redesign, error handling, stakeholder coordination, and final deployment into managed environments.

Booz Allen Hamilton | SharePoint Site Consolidation and Automation

Architected and implemented a scalable SharePoint solution for Booz Allen Hamilton's federal client as a SharePoint and .NET consultant. The project focused on consolidating redundant SharePoint 2013 sites, optimizing workflow efficiency, and addressing security gaps. I delivered modern Microsoft Power Platform based automation and improved governance structures.

INPO | Business Intelligence Portal for Industry Metrics

Designed and developed a custom SharePoint-based BI portal for the Institute of Nuclear Power Operations (INPO) to centralize industry KPIs. I leveraged FAST Search, metadata tagging, and WPF-based dashboards to present real-time data insights. The solution reduced manual data processing time by over 70% and greatly improved department decision-making.

Microsoft Power Platform Dashboards and Workflow Automation

Developed and deployed custom dashboards and automation workflows across multiple agencies using Microsoft Power Platform and SharePoint 2013. These reusable components enabled real-time reporting, reduced manual reporting errors, and standardized cross-departmental communication.

Booz Allen Hamilton | Secure API Integration for SharePoint and Microsoft 365

Designed and implemented secure, REST-based integrations between SharePoint Online and third-party platforms using Microsoft Graph API. I also ensured data integrity and compliance across enterprise applications while simplifying user access to critical external systems through automated Microsoft Power Platform workflows.
